New Delhi, 4 July
KPCC President BK Hariprasad on Saturday questioned the Centre over the rollout of 20 per cent ethanol-blended petrol, alleging it has caused vehicle breakdowns, reduced mileage and increased maintenance costs.
In a post on X, he claimed motorists across the country were facing widespread problems after the introduction of E20 fuel. Hariprasad alleged that despite higher ethanol blending, the Narendra Modi-led government had not reduced fuel prices, forcing consumers to pay more while receiving lower mileage.
He demanded transparency, scientific evidence and consumer protection for the ethanol-blending programme, urging the Centre to explain why fuel prices have not fallen and address growing concerns raised by vehicle owners.
